Transaction 2bafaa32f19c587b7370f564b0a40aaa42a848eaff493d9b0a13057666d3bdb3
1 Input
1 Output
-
2bafaa32f19c587b7370f564b0a40aaa42a848eaff493d9b0a13057666d3bdb3:0
- value
- 2599577
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 330cd70cd55d57992b085bc30984920925b81240 OP_EQUAL
- address
- 36LwmU8wgahAjjjj42xi273RXtuXpaWRjz